This volume is about studies of Shen Congwen (1902–1988), one of the most important writers in modern China, but more importantly, it is about how Shen Congwen has been received in and beyond Mainland China. By presenting the best literary criticism on Shen Congwen in Mainland China over the past 80 years, and views of how Shen Congwen has been understood, interpreted, and appreciated in Japan, the US, and Europe, the editors propose a new way to approach the topics of canonic writers, modern Chinese literature, and world literature.This is itself a translated project. Its Chinese edition appeared in May 2017. The bilingual rendering of the best criticism of Shen Congwen from a global perspective intends to initiate and advance dialogues between Chinese- and English- language scholarly communities. We strive to explore the complexities of “worldwide” images and interpretations of Shen Congwen. By calling attention to the foreign spaces into which overseas Shen Congwens and modern Chinese literature are reborn as world literature, we acknowledge and celebrate the study of Shen Congwen and modern Chinese literature as ongoing and endless cross-cultural dialogues and manifestations.

In-depth monograph presenting innovative radical methodologies in the Brook rearrangement and their utility in organic synthesisRadical Brook Rearrangement chronicles the evolution of radical Brook rearrangements, synthesizes recent advances in the field, and outlines future research directions. The book focuses on three key reactive intermediates — α-siloxy radicals, siloxycarbenes, and silenes — providing detailed analyses of their generation methods, substrate scope, mechanistic insights, and synthetic applications, along with practical experimental protocols.Readers will find insights on alkoxy radical generation, photocatalytic systems, and the selection of radical/carbene acceptors. This book deliberately focuses on radical processes, excluding anionic pathways.Written by a team of highly qualified researchers in the field, Radical Brook Rearrangement includes information on: Generation of siloxycarbenes for metal siloxycarbene reaction, with information on aminooxycarbene reactionsGeneration of siloxycarbenes for nucleophilic addition reaction, covering aldehydes and ketones as electrophiles and other electrophilic reagentsGeneration of α-siloxy silyl radicals with (TMS)3SiOH, covering photoredox reactions and metallaphotoredox reactions with (TMS)3SiNHAdGeneration of α-siloxy radicals with α-silyl alcohol, covering metal-free, metal-catalyzed, photocatalyzed, and electrophotocatalyzed reactionsContaining cutting-edge research discoveries on the subject, Radical Brook Rearrangement is an essential reference for chemists across specializations, materials scientists, and professionals in the pharmaceutical industry.
